草庐IT

cv画图

全部标签

0x00007FF872444FD9 处(位于 Project1.exe 中)有未经处理的异常: Microsoft C++ 异常: cv::Exception,位于内存位置 0x000000F11

0x00007FF872444FD9处(位于Project1.exe中)有未经处理的异常:MicrosoftC++异常:cv::Exception,位于内存位置0x000000F11317EFB8处。解决方法将读取文件的路径改为双“\" Matimage=imread("D:\\opencv_learn\\Project1\\tu1.jpg"); Matlogo=imread("D:\\opencv_learn\\Project1\\tu2.jpg");或将图片放置在工程文件下下方,并直接读取查看链接器-输入-附加依赖,Debugx64应该为opencv_world***d.lib,查看一下是

cv2.error: OpenCV(4.7.0) D:\a\opencv-python\opencv-python\opencv\modules\imgcodecs\src\loadsave.cpp:

报错解决1.报错信息2.解决2.1解决过程2.1解决成功1.报错信息cv2.error:OpenCV(4.7.0)D:\a\opencv-python\opencv-python\opencv\modules\imgcodecs\src\loadsave.cpp:1116:error:(-2:Unspecifiederror)couldnotfindencoderforthespecifiedextensioninfunction'cv::imencode'2.解决2.1解决过程根据报错行提示,显示输出文件有问题,以为是文件路径有问题修改成相对路径与绝对路径都没有用查找的报错都和我的报错信息不

python cv2.HoughCircles 霍夫圆检测

HoughCircles使用与说明1.HoughCircles说明2.代码3.结果cv2提供了一种圆检测的方法:HoughCircles。该函数的返回结果与参数设置有很大的关系。检测的图像时9枚钱币,分别使用了阈值(大津法和三角法)、均值偏移滤波以及未处理图像。实验的结果是只要调整param1和param2两个参数,上述方法都能准确的识别图像中的圆形。与圆最贴切的是大津法阈值。使用该方法同时需要使用cv2.THRESHOLD_TRUNC。1.HoughCircles说明函数定义如下:HoughCircles(image,method,dp,minDist,circles=None,param1

Python matplotlib 画图 字体、字体大小、字体粗细、文字方向、斜体、旋转角度 全集

Pythonmatplotlib画图字体、字体大小、字体粗细、文字方向、斜体统一设置单独设置设置字体font设置坐标轴axes字体大小labelsize设置标签tick字体大小labelsize设置坐标轴axes字体粗细labelweight设置标签tick字体粗细labelweight可选粗细有['light','normal','medium','semibold','bold','heavy','black']可选样式['normal','italic','oblique']旋转角度rotation1.全局设置方式一fromproplotimportrcimportmatplotlib.

Pycharm里opencv(cv2) 提示在 __init__.py 中找不到任何 OpenCV 函数的引用

​本小白踩坑记录遇到这个问题时,看了很多大神的帖子,包括在解释器里添加.pyd文件的路径、把importcv2改成importcv2.cv2、重装opencv等,我试了都没效果。最后发现其实问题很简单,opencv和Python版本不对应。。。。。在pycharm里和cmd里安装时如果输入:pipinstallopencv_python默认安装的版本和系统里的Python不一定匹配我的是Python3.6,下载opencv_python‑3.3.0‑cp36‑cp36m‑win32.whl到本地后用pip安装(这里应该是带cp36的win版本都行,可根据安装的Python版本3.x去找cp3x

Python cv2 opencv-python opencv-contrib-python 安装

老规矩,话不多说,上代码!pipinstallopencv-python(如果只用主模块,则使用这个命令安装【推荐】)pipinstallopencv-contrib-python(如果需要用到contrib模块,则使用这个命令【本次因自己没有使用contrib模块,所以没有尝试】)首先,讲一下cv2这个模块是opencv的,所以安装的时候使用的是opencv-python。安装完找到安装第三方库的目录下,可以看到有cv2这个模块,以及含有版本信息的opencv_python-4.6.0.66.dist-info(本人此次下载安装的版本,各位到时候对应自己的版本即可)目录。写代码时,直接imp

Python(matplotlib)画图设置正斜体,及中文宋体、英文Timenews--用于论文画图,导出高清晰图像

一、设置图像x、y两轴及文本标签内容为中文宋体、英文Timenews,字体为10.5磅在代码钱加入:config={"font.family":'serif',"font.size":10.5,"mathtext.fontset":'stix',"font.serif":['SimSun'],}rcParams.update(config)%configInlineBackend.figure_format='retina'%matplotlibinlineimportnumpyasnpimportmathimportmatplotlib.pyplotaspltfrommatplotlibim

Qt绘制曲线图(基于qt画图QPainter)

在没有QCharst模块时,可以使用QPainter自定义绘制曲线折线图下面提供完整代码供参考:直接在qt创建一个QMainWindow类的app的工程,不自动生成ui文件,然后把下面代码复制到mainwindow.cpp编译运行即可。mainwindow.cpp:#include"mainwindow.h"#include#include#include#include//使用QPainter将数据到曲线画在图片中QImageimageCurve(constQVectorint>&data1,constQVectorint>&data2);MainWindow::MainWindow(QWi

写文、画图、替人直播,小巨头混战AIGC

 文|光锥智能,作者|黄小艺、郝鑫,编辑|刘雨琦大模型的春风,吹乱了内容平台们的心。作为“被革命”的第一梯队,内容平台们跃跃欲试,欲抢占时间窗口。5月6日,小红书被曝开始筹备大模型团队;4月上线了一款主打AI绘画功能的创作应用;4月13日,知乎抢发“知海图AI”中文大模型,将其运用进知乎热榜,上线“热榜摘要”新功能并开启内测;3月24日,快手MMU自然语言处理中心、音频中心负责人张富峥曾在某次公开活动上透露,快手也在搭建大模型,已在短视频创作、广告创意、电商直播、虚拟偶像、剧本创作等场景落地了AIGC解决方案;2月,字节跳动被曝在大模型上已有所布局,分别在语言和图像两种模态上发力,探索方向主要

python 安装 cv2 失败

我在安装cv2时出现以下错误图一 图二 出现图二原因有两种:1.《不兼容》:第一是最麻烦的一种python的版本和第三方库互相不兼容,比如现在的python11和tensorflow是不兼容。这个时候最简单的办法就是降低python的版本。2.《库的名不对》:这个是最容易出现错误的比如:                    skimage的全名scikit-image                    cv2的全名opencv-python我们这里出现的就是第二种《库的名不对》用pip安装的时候把cv2改成 opencv-python就OK了pipinstallopencv-python